Munshi Niyaz Ud-Din
bookseller
Munshi Niyaz Ud-Din was the founder of Kutub Khana Anjuman-e-Taraqqi-e-Urdu in 1937, establishing a legacy of Urdu literature that continues through his descendants, despite the challenges faced by the Urdu Bazaar today.
